What to Wear
-
Hiking boots or very sturdy sneakers are a MUST for this hike, the trail is very rocky and involves some scrambling
-
Weather-appropriate, moisture-wicking, athletic clothing (wear or bring layers!)
-
Wool or synthetic socks
-
Sunglasses (optional)
-
Hat (optional)
